# Snapshot testing config for the Larkspur UI kit. Snapshots are rendered
# headlessly and diffed against baselines stored per component; any pixel
# drift over the threshold fails the build. Reviewers should reject baseline
# updates that lack a linked design note. Baselines and diff metadata are
# persisted so runs are comparable across branches. The test harness records
# results in the snapshot database using the connection string below.

primary connection of tajeg-tajop = postgresql://julax_svc:DI@db-e7f3.kelvidyn.corp:5432/rusdor

TURN-208: Gatevale turnstile counters at the Merrow Field pilot double-count when a rotation reverses mid-cycle. Attendance totals drift roughly 2% high per event. The debounce window fix is implemented, reviewed by Ilsa, and soak-tested across two simulated match days without drift. Ready for your cut; the candidate build is identified below.

trace token, tagag-tafog: htk6_5ed18c

Subject: Handover — Migration Pipeline

Hi Revik,

Handing over the Bramblehart migration pipeline. All schema changes use expand-contract: add nullable columns, dual-write for one release, backfill in batches, then drop. The `mig_ledger` table tracks phase state; never skip the contract confirmation step. Runbooks are in the usual wiki space. The ledger lives on the ops cluster, reachable with the string below.

— Odaline

primary connection of tawif-yajeg = postgresql://rusiel_svc:G879q9cx6GsSvj@db-dd9f.norvagrid.internal:5432/casath

Subject: DR drill — SquatGuard scanner restore

Team, the quarterly disaster-recovery drill for SquatGuard, our typo-squatting package scanner, ran Tuesday. Restore from the Velmora cold backup completed in 41 minutes. Future maintainers: the scanner index rebuilds automatically, but the vault unlock step is manual. Keep this message with the runbook, since the unlock step requires the recovery passphrase recorded here.

unlock words, kajef-kadug: sorys-pelax-lamael-tamvan-briiel-novdor-fenwyn-tamdor-oliion-keleth-julok-belion-ralok